Photovoltaic Inverter Startup Sequence: 6 Non-Negotiable Steps

Based on the 2023 Afore Technical Manual and NEC 690.12 standards:

  1. Battery Breaker Closure: Isolate DC sources first (prevents backfeed)
  2. Inverter Power-Up: Engage the marine switch for control board initialization
  3. PV Array Connection: Connect panels after inverter self-test completes

3 Advanced Techniques for Commercial-Scale Systems

For >100kW installations, consider:

“Pre-charging DC buses through current-limiting resistors minimizes inrush currents—a game-changer for 1500V systems.” — SolarPro Magazine (March 2024)
